Default 04 Monte keeps blowing fuse for dome and Map lights.

My dad hasa 04 Monte that keeps blowing the fuse for the Map lights, Dome & the trunk light.
I had changed the fuse and everything worked for a few hours then it blows again.
I don't think it's the door switch because the foot well lights come on and the Door ajar light comes on when a door is opened.
Also when turning the lights on uising the headlight switch the foot well lights come on.

I have seen a few Monte Carlo's blow this fuse because the power wire going to the lighted vanity mirror in the left or right sunshade is pinched where the sunshade pivot mounts to the roof or the power wire is mis-routed and one of the sunshade mounting screws has pierced the wire insulation.

Just wanted to give a update. Saturday we put a new fuse in and it blew right away. So after checking the wiring harness above the headliner coming from the visors and going back to the trunk. We couldn't find any bare wires. Also did not see any bare spots in the trunk. So we unplugged the sun visors and that resolved the issue. So it appears that it's a short in one of the visors. We didn't try plugging them in one at time because he never used the lights in the visors and didn't care that they don't work.
